CECD created new life for me

This 2015 rice crop, Mrs. Tac - a single lady in Ngo Village is so happy with her rice crop as she got double rice amount than last year thanks for CECD support in introduction of new rice variety and new organic cultivation technology. She is now carrying her rice home for drying and storage. She is happy as from now on her household will have enough food around the year.
